Where this album fits

Career context
By the time 'Throne Room' was released in 2003, CeCe Winans had already established herself as a leading figure in contemporary gospel music, following her successful albums like 'Alone in His Presence' (1995) and 'Everlasting Love' (2000). This album marked a continuation of her artistic evolution, showcasing her vocal prowess and deepening spiritual themes.
